Q. What is the endosymbiotic hypothesis about the origin of mitochondria? And what are the molecular facts that support the hypothesis? And To which other cellular organelles can the hypothesis also be applied?
It is presumed that mitochondria were primitive aerobic prokaryotes that were engulfed in mutualism by primitive anaerobic eukaryotes receiving protection from these beings and offering energy to them. This hypothesis is known as the endosymbiotic hypothesis on the origin of mitochondria.
The hypothesis is strengthened by some molecular evidence such as the fact that mitochondria have their protein synthesis machinery and own independent DNA, with their own ribosomes and RNA, and that they can self- replicate.
The endosymbiotic theory can be applied to chloroplasts too It is supposed that these organelles were primitive photosynthetic prokaryotes because they have their own DNA, ribosomes and RNA and they can self- replicate too.
